The tariff classification parts of fuel dispensers from Germany
Issued October 14, 2010 by U.S. Customs and Border Protection.
Tariff classification
HTS codes: 7411.10.1090, 8413.91.9080
Product description
The articles in question are described as parts of fuel dispensers. The parts include feedline tube assemblies, framing and housing components, canopy assemblies, electrical bezel assemblies and cosmetic skins for the front of the fuel dispenser. The feedline assemblies are preformed seamless tubes of copper with welded fittings used to bring gasoline from underground tanks to the fuel dispensers. The remaining parts are used to form the finished structure of the fuel dispensers. The fuel dispensers, which were previously considered in New York ruling N115656, are classified in subheading 8413.11.0000, Harmonized Tariff Schedule of the United States (HTSUS), which provides for pumps for dispensing fuel, of the type used in filling-stations or in garages.
CBP rationale
The applicable subheading for the feedline tube assemblies will be 7411.10.1090, HTSUS, which provides for copper tubes and pipes, of refined copper, seamless, other. The applicable subheading for the remaining parts described above will be 8413.91.9080, HTSUS, which provides for other parts of liquid pumps.

The rate of duty will be 1.5 percent ad valorem. The applicable subheading for the remaining parts described above will be 8413.91.9080, HTSUS, which provides for other parts of liquid pumps. The rate of duty is free. Duty rates are provided for your convenience and are subject to change.
